many, many years ago I guided turkey hunting at Stagshead Lodge in Greene Co for Wayne Fears. One day he asked me if I would guide Charlie Elliot turkey hunting. Holy cow!!!! Never figured in a million years I would guide probably the most famous turkey hunter in the South in the 60's and 70's. Very cool fella. Had a great time.
Later I got to guide Bill Jordan of Border Patrol fame turkey hunting. His big hands made a 44Mag look small, he was a BIG man. Had a ball guiding him.

a friend in Wilcox Co asked me to come down and guide a fella for him, I didn't know the guy and met him at the Bassmaster Inn at 4am the next Sat. Older fella. I carried him to a property Roy owned and we got out to listen. Fella had a short barrelled double sxs shotgun. WTH? We got on a bird pretty quick but he didn't want to come to where we set up. After a while he asked if he could call. Damn, he sounded better than me. Now he tells me he shot at this bird the day before in this same area. And his gun is a custom made Perazziti(sp) with full and full 24 inch tubes!!!. ...and he has killed several hundred turkeys in his life.....

Roy was real bad to leave out important information ....
